Anti-Narcotics Force (ANF) Intelligence on Saturday foiled a bid to smuggle 40 kg heroin from Karachi to the United Kingdom (UK). According to an ANF Headquarters spokesman, ANF Karachi and ANF Intelligence conducted a raid and managed to recover 40 kg heroin from a parcel containing packets of black pepper powder booked for UK. The spokesman informed that a case has been registered while further investigation was in progress. Efforts were underway to arrest the accused, he added.
